The expert assessed the possibilities of Europe to increase renewable energy generation

MOSCOW, August 31 – PRIME. Europe in the current foreign policy and economic conditions is not ready to increase the volume of generation based on renewable sources (RES), the EU would be wiser to return to the use of nuclear energy, said RIA Novosti acting. Rector of the Russian Chemical Technical University named after D. I. Mendeleev Ilya Vorotyntsev.

The head of the European Commission, Ursula von der Leyen, said earlier that the European Commission is working on reforming the EU electricity market. According to her, the EU is investing 300 billion euros in green energy as part of the rejection of Russian fossil energy resources.

“European officials like to sign and release new global programs for the transition to green energy with beautiful numbers when they are successfully achieved. But money does not fall from the sky, and the aforementioned 300 billion will be collected through increased tax burden,” he said.

The tax burden, in his opinion, may, for example, increase due to the growth of taxes on carbon dioxide emissions, which will lead to an increase in the cost of generating electricity from gas and coal. “All this will affect the life of every household in the European Union,” Vorotyntsev is sure.

The current global environment, complicated by natural disasters, broken supply chains, rising energy prices, and reduced purchasing power of the population, together cannot allow significant funds to be allocated to start a correct and efficient transition to renewable energy. “At the moment, definitely not,” the expert commented on Europe’s readiness to increase renewable energy generation.

Vorotyntsev believes that in the current situation, it would be much more logical for the EU countries to operate the “peaceful atom”, namely, to use the existing nuclear power plants and de-mothball the old ones. At the same time, he is sure that the EU’s complete rejection of Russian energy sources in the short term is unlikely, including due to the fact that electricity production in Europe, as well as the provision of industrial and domestic needs, is currently critically dependent on Russian exports.
